    This week, you’ve got two episodes in one! Both were recorded live on stage at Unlock by Zillow in November 2025. The first half takes you inside The Nickley Group in Florida and the second half takes you inside HomeTeam4U in Wisconsin.

    TOM AND ALEXIS NICKLEY
    Alexis and Tom Nickley, co-team leaders of The Nickley Group in Orlando, credit team culture with the growth and success of their 65-agent, 20-staff real estate team pacing for 900 transactions and $400M in sales.

    Learn two key roles, four core values, and three things they’re focused on in the year ahead!

    JEN STAUTER
    Jen Stauter serves as team leader of HomeTeam4U in Sun Prairie, Wisconsin. She walks you through the personality types that work within their 32-agent organization, how she plans to get to 50 agents, two specific ways the Agent Success Coordinator roles has helped her and the team, a unique quality of their mentorship program, and more!

    After earning two degrees in architecture and starting your career with a design firm, you get into real estate operations.

    Your first task: turn a real estate team into an independent brokerage. Overnight, if possible.
    Your second task: expand and renovate the office to prepare for growth.
    Meanwhile: you need to get the systems and processes out of people’s heads, merge them together, get it documented, redesign onboarding, and teach it to agents.

    That’s just some of what you’ll get in this conversation with Matteo Zingales, Director of Operations at Team Zingales Realty, a family-owned, independent teamerage.
